Transaction 12336413626417f53811263c716d30370884b2490304f20611e9297a7d679f26
1 Input
2 Outputs
- 12336413626417f53811263c716d30370884b2490304f20611e9297a7d679f26:0
- 12336413626417f53811263c716d30370884b2490304f20611e9297a7d679f26:1
value 24991000
address 3N5t1K4xskUMBvZfMVJ2SyD67w8UMHevvV
value 40974660
address 1KrFE7wqjYXC2mensBA9mMdTw5xk43TRxc